THE APPLICATION OF MODEL PROBLEM BASED LEARNING (PBL) AGAINST STUDENT RESULTS IN SENIOR HIGH SCHOOL 11 SAMARINDA Paulina Cerling; Muliati Syam; Muhammad Junus

Abstract

This study aims to determine the increase in student learning outcomes of class XI IPA 1 senior high school 11 Samarinda after applying the PBL model to the Static Fluid material and to find out student responses about the application of the PBL model in static fluid learning. The research used One Group Pretest-Posttest Design method on Static Fluid material. The technique used was purposive sampling with the sample of this study were 35 students of class XI IPA 1 senior high school 11 Samarinda. The instruments used were written questions and questionnaires. Based on the results of the study showed that the average N-Gain was 0.69. The results of the t-test calculation showed that a significant level of learning outcomes and students' responses to PBL was in a good category or criteria.
